MySQL 日期和时间数据类型
醉逍遥
2024-12-29 11:00:38
0
MySQL 日期和时间数据类型 MySQL 是一个流行的关系型数据库管理系统,支持多种数据类型,其中包括日期和时间数据类型。正确处理日期和时间数据对于数据库应用程序至关重要,因为它们通常涉及到日程安排、事件跟踪、数据分析等关键任务。本文将详细介绍 MySQL 中的日期和时间数据类型。 一、MySQL 日期和时间数据类型概览 MySQL 提供了多种日期和时间数据类型,以适应不同的应用需求。这些数据类型包括:DATE、TIME、DATETIME、TIMESTAMP、YEAR 等。下面我们将逐一介绍这些数据类型及其特点。 二、各日期和时间数据类型的详细介绍

1. DATE 数据类型

新品轻便保暖高筒防滑雨鞋女加绒胶靴防水雨靴加棉水鞋成人工作鞋
【雨鞋】新品轻便保暖高筒防滑雨鞋女加绒胶靴防水雨靴加棉水鞋成人工作鞋售价:48.00元 领券价:48元 邮费:0.00
DATE 数据类型用于存储日期值,格式为 'YYYY-MM-DD'。它不包含时间信息,只包含日期信息。 2. TIME 数据类型 TIME 数据类型用于存储时间值,格式为 'HH:MM:SS'。它不包含日期信息,只包含时间信息。 3. DATETIME 数据类型 DATETIME 数据类型用于存储日期和时间值,格式为 'YYYY-MM-DD HH:MM:SS'。它同时包含日期和时间信息。 4. TIMESTAMP 数据类型 TIMESTAMP 数据类型也用于存储日期和时间值,但其范围和存储方式与 DATETIME 略有不同。TIMESTAMP 通常用于存储带有时区的日期和时间信息,并且可以自动将时间值转换为 UTC(协调世界时)。 5. YEAR 数据类型 YEAR 数据类型用于存储年份值,可以是有两个或四个数字的年份。这种数据类型通常用于存储只需要年份信息的场景。 三、日期和时间数据类型的用法和注意事项 在使用 MySQL 的日期和时间数据类型时,需要注意以下几点: 1. 选择合适的数据类型:根据应用需求选择合适的数据类型,以确保数据的准确性和存储效率。 2. 日期和时间的表示方式:遵循 MySQL 的日期和时间格式规范,以确保数据的正确性和可读性。 3. 时区处理:如果需要处理时区相关的日期和时间信息,建议使用 TIMESTAMP 数据类型,并确保服务器和客户端都支持相应的时区设置。

4. 索引和查询优化:对日期和时间字段进行索引和查询优化,以提高数据库的性能和响应速度。

开门款包包鞋化妆品展示防尘盒罩模型动漫积木手办储物收纳整理箱
【收纳箱】开门款包包鞋化妆品展示防尘盒罩模型动漫积木手办储物收纳整理箱售价:10.00元 领券价:5元 邮费:0.00
5. 数据验证和转换:在插入和查询数据时,确保日期和时间数据的正确性和一致性,必要时进行数据验证和转换操作。 四、总结 MySQL 的日期和时间数据类型为开发人员提供了灵活的解决方案,可以满足各种应用场景的需求。正确使用这些数据类型可以提高数据库的性能、准确性和可维护性。因此,在设计和开发数据库应用程序时,请务必仔细考虑并选择合适的日期和时间数据类型。

上一篇:MySQL 联合数据类型

下一篇:没有了

相关内容

热门资讯

mysql 多个站点的近30天... SELECT j.title, ( SELECT sum( realoil_price ) FROM...
mysql Please DI... mysql插入数据表时总是提示 Please DISCARD the tablespace befo...
sql 批量修改表前缀 示例:将dede_前缀修改成xiong_前缀 先查询以 dede_ 前缀的表: 需要修改的部分:re...
tp5中MySQL如何获取JS... 第一种: // 假设$user是从数据库中查询出的用户信息 $user = Db::name(use...
mysql 一次查询,返回多个... 问题描述: 在一个表中有多个条件,其中两个条件是共同的,另外两个条件是不同,一条sql语句返回多个统...
mysql把表中数据插入到其他... 两张字段相同的表,一张作为产品库,一张作为自定义库,每增一个新客户就把产品库中的所有数据插入到...
phpstudy在linux上... 开始配置 在线安装phpstudy一键包: 1.在Xshell里面输入wget -c http://...
navicate测试登录Acc... 安全组3306已经放行。宝塔【安全】中也放行3306。使用账号密码在navicate上登录数据库,出...
sql注入方法及防御危害 S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服...
使用Linux安装phpstu... 问题描述: 买了阿里云,配置好PHPstudy后好久没用,后来登录mysql,忘记密码,所以登录不上...